2-Tridecanol
2-Tridecanol is a metabolite that can be found in extra virgin coconut oil, and serves as a growth substrate for Pseudomonas multivorans. 2-Tridecanol can be metabolized by Pseudomonas multivorans and Pseudomonas aeruginosa to produce 2-tridecanone, undecyl acetate, and 1-undecanol, and acts as a metabolic intermediate in their 2-tridecanone catabolic pathway.

Microbial Metabolite |
2-Tridecanol (0.2-0.3%) is metabolized by Pseudomonas multivorans strain 4G-9 via interconversion to 2-tridecanone, with subsequent production of undecyl acetate and 1-undecanol as key metabolites[1].
2-Tridecanol constitutes 8% of the total free fatty alcohol fraction in aerobically grown Escherichia coli K-12 cells[3].
2-Tridecanol constitutes only 1% of the total free fatty alcohol fraction in anaerobically grown Escherichia coli K-12 cellss[3].
2-Tridecanol (200 ppm) exhibits moderate granary weevil progeny-suppressive activity[5].
